About the conference

As every year, the 2022 European Divorce Network meeting will take place in mid-October. If the circumstances permit, we will meet in person in the Czech city of Brno on October 13 – 15th. The conference will be hosted by the Faculty of Social Studies of Masaryk University.

This time, it will be the 20th annual meeting of the EUDIV network, which has gradually become one of the most important platform for bringing together researchers in the fields of sociology, demography and population studies who deal with the topic of divorce.

Preliminary schedule

The call for abstracts has been released in February 2022. The submission deadline has been extended to May 15. Authors will be notified of acceptance/non-acceptance of their abstract by the end of May 2022 and conference registration will also open at this time. As the long-term developments regarding the covid-19 pandemic are hard to predict, and the Russian aggression against Ukraine introduced new source of uncertainity, the final decision on the format of the conference (online, offline) will not be reached before August 2022. Please make sure to adjust your travel plans accordingly. We do not plan to take a hybrid conference format. There are no conference fees.
